Ordinals
beta
Sat 1685947036362434
decimal
508757.786362434
degree
0°88757′725″786362434‴
percentile
80.28319229604651%
name
bxfspnlzrbb
cycle
0
epoch
2
period
252
block
508757
offset
786362434
timestamp
2018-02-12 02:59:23 UTC
rarity
common
prev
next